How do you family share on Minecraft Java?

Using the family share feature, Minecraft Bedrock Edition can be shared by several users with only one purchase. However, this is not possible with Java Edition, which requires a purchase for each user.

Can 2 people play on the same Minecraft Java account?

A multiplayer server allows two or more players to play Minecraft together. You can either download the server file needed to set up your own server from Minecraft.net or connect to another person's server. Note: To access a server you need to run the same version of Minecraft as the server.

Can I play Minecraft on multiple computers?

Note: Minecraft purchases are tied to your account (email address) and not a device. As such, you can download and install Minecraft: Java Edition on as many computers as you want.

How do I buy Minecraft Java for someone else?

Gifting Through the Windows Store
  1. Navigate to the Minecraft: Java & Bedrock Edition for PC Store Page.
  2. Select the “…” option and click 'Buy as Gift. ...
  3. Enter the email address of the account in which you'd like to send the gift.
  4. Enter your sender name (the name the recipient will see upon receiving the gift.)

How do I enable multiplayer games on Microsoft family?

Allow or block multiplayer games

As the organizer of your family group, you can decide if a member can play multiplayer games with their friends. Open the Xbox Family Settings app, and then go to Settings. Select the Multiplayer tile, and then select the toggle switch to block or allow multiplayer features.

How do I allow games on Microsoft family?

Visit family.microsoft.com and sign into your Microsoft account. Find your family member and click Content Filters. Go to Apps and Games. Under Allow apps and games rated for, designate the age limit for content they will have permission to access.
